Sounds like your school requires that you fill out another form on top of the FAFSA. I searched the "Need Access" application and this is what came up:
http://www.needaccess.org
You are correct that Stafford Unsubsidized Loans and GradPLUS Loans are not need-based loans and are awarded through completion of the FAFSA application. Perhaps your school has a second application to determine eligibility for university-based grants?
